Facebook recently updated (a couple of days ago for me)

Just warning people to check mobile phone settings for FB

A number of people I know who had the same update have found FB has reverted settings back to 'Video Autoplay over Wifi and Mobile Network' Even if (like me) they had it previously turned off

This could be one of the reasons your data is being gobbled up....:smileysad:
